Transaction 0f6627ffdb680ec66d0fce7da2317429fc2e46e636ebe3e89a541ef99c70eb50

1 Input
2 Outputs
  • 0f6627ffdb680ec66d0fce7da2317429fc2e46e636ebe3e89a541ef99c70eb50:0
  • value  51000000
    address  3HgyKwwbHyYWRyejqSio8BdC7DdAymQTPY
  • 0f6627ffdb680ec66d0fce7da2317429fc2e46e636ebe3e89a541ef99c70eb50:1
  • value  63954430
    address  12eeTUPXVLB2bQtuTGHysSRMwZgu46amjk